this morning I went to turn on the light in my 55G cichlid tank, I noticed that they were all kinda of sluggish, never thot anything of it.... so tonite i come home and im really worried, all my fish are soooo slow and my blood parrot was laying on his side kinda, so i pulled out my testers and everything was good, amo:0 nitrite:0 and ph:7.6 I was really curious what this was, i told my dad and he said, go check the temp, which i acually forget to check, and it was 66 celcious!!! thats FREEEZING!!! i got all panicy and looked and my dang heater got unplugged, the filter was also like 1/4 plugged in, now i must investigate how it got unplugged and almost wiped out my tank..... STUPID CAT!!!

We had some safety covers for outlets that protect kids from removing any plugs and getting shocked. It's a dome-like thing that screws on AFTER you plug in your stuff. You might want to look into one for your fish tank plugs just to be safe. ( then the cat will just chew through the cords) :crazy:
